The Washington Suburban Sanitary Commission is soliciting professional engineering services to update their all-pipes sewer basin models and incorporate updated sewer network information and recent flow meter data. The work supports simulation of wet- and dry-weather flows for design storms and development of future flow projections using regional demographic data. The solicitation is for a planning/basic ordering agreement to provide updates and ongoing modeling support.
